You may not realize it, but behind the scenes the Federal Reserve is quietly influencing your everyday life when it comes to borrowing, saving and even spending. Serving as the central bank of the United States, the Federal Reserve, or Fed, is responsible for managing the countrys monetary policy. A big part of its job is adjusting the federal funds ratethe short-term interest rate banks charge each other to lend funds overnight. First, most Americans have become so used to the benefits of government that they simply take them for granted. But the internet actually began with government programs that created ARPANET and later NSFNET, early computer networking systems that developed the software and networking infrastructure that form the foundations of todays internet.
